If the key fob's buttons won't work or the range of its operation shrinks, it might require a new battery. To replace the battery, you must remove the auxiliary key made of metal and then open the case of the key fob. To open the case you can use a tape-wrapped screwdriver. The battery of the key fob is hidden behind a slot in the case. It is visible when you remove the auxiliary key. Security The 2022 Mazda 3 provides anti-theft protection via two primary sources such as a theft alarm system, as well as an immobilizer. The alarm will sound and flash if someone attempts to enter your vehicle. The immobilizer stops the engine from running.
